A bag contains 3 red balls and 2 blue balls. If one ball is drawn at random, what is the probability that it is red?
Correct Answer: 3/5
Step 1: Count the number of red balls in the bag. There are 3 red balls.
Step 2: Count the number of blue balls in the bag. There are 2 blue balls.
Step 3: Add the number of red balls and blue balls together to find the total number of balls. 3 red + 2 blue = 5 total balls.
Step 4: To find the probability of drawing a red ball, divide the number of red balls by the total number of balls. This is 3 red balls divided by 5 total balls.
Step 5: Write the probability as a fraction: 3/5.
Probability – The likelihood of an event occurring, calculated as the number of favorable outcomes divided by the total number of possible outcomes.
Counting Outcomes – Understanding how to count the total number of outcomes and favorable outcomes in a probability scenario.
